Description:

A Large Group of Miscellaneous Sterling Silver Flatware, late 19th/early 20th c., comprising Gorham "Cambridge" pattern, introduced 1899, 8 teaspoons, 6 pastry forks, and 1 tablespoon; Gorham "Lancaster" pattern, introduced 1897, 7 teaspoons and 1 butter knife; Durgin "Marechal", pattern, c. 1896, 3 tablespoons; Towle "Georgian" pattern, c. 1898, 5 teaspoons; Reed & Barton "Hepplewhite" pattern, 1907, 5 dinner forks and 6 dinner knives; Durgin "Madame Royale" pattern, c. 1897, 12 butter spreaders and 1 pastry fork; 5 souvenir spoons, Texas, St. Louis, North Carolina, Missouri and Kentucky; and 14 misc. pieces, approx. 72 pcs., total combined weight 56.75 troy ozs.
